Kitui West MP Edith Nyenze has been recognized among the country’s top-performing female lawmakers in an latest Infotrak poll assessing performance in Parliament. The survey evaluated MPs based on representation, legislation, and oversight roles.
According to the poll results highlighted in the news update, Samburu West MP Naisula Lesuuda emerged as the best-performing female MP in the country. Lesuuda topped the ranking after receiving strong ratings across the key parliamentary functions.
Aldai MP Marianna Kitany was placed second in the rankings, while Edith Nyenze secured a position among the leading female lawmakers recognized by the survey.
The rankings have sparked discussions on the contribution of women leaders in Parliament, with many observers pointing to increased participation in legislation, public representation, and oversight responsibilities as important measures of performance.
